West Bengal retail jewellers protest against PAN declaration compulsion

diamond world news service

The jewellery retailers in West Bengal protested yesterday against the mandate for customers to declare the PAN number when buying jewellery of Rs.1 lakh and above, reports say. There were more than 10,000 jewellers who protested and felt the rule was unjust.

Although the industry believes the Central government is working to control black money, but there also has not been any respite on high gold import duty of 10 percent. The new compulsion regarding the PAN number has further disturbed the jewellers. The large number of retailers in protest would have caused a huge loss to these state and central government.
